Freeport LNG Marketing, LLC v. Kinder Morgan Texas Pipeline LLC
The Fourteenth Court of Appeals reversed summary judgment in favor of Kinder Morgan in a natural gas supply dispute with Freeport LNG, finding disputed fact issues regarding whether Winter Storm Uri and related governmental actions excused the midstream operator's refusal to honor sell-back obligations under a NAESB Base Contract. The court held that Kinder Morgan failed to establish as a matter of law the causation element required under the contract's force majeure provisions, which excluded economic hardship and loss of gas supply except as specifically enumerated.
